Embeddings Intermediate ⏱ 1 hour 🎓 Free Course

Embedding Models: Architecture to Implementation

By DeepLearning.AI · June 19, 2026

4.5/5

Course Overview

DeepLearning.AI’s Embedding Models course teaches intermediate practitioners how to design, train, and deploy embedding architectures. In 2026, mastering embeddings is essential for search, recommendation, and LLM‑enhanced products. The hour‑long, self‑paced format fits busy professionals seeking pr

1 hour
Duration
Self‑paced
Intermediate
Level
Prereq: ML
Free
Cost
No credit card
5 modules
Modules
Core topics
Overall Rating: 4.5/5  |  Best For: Data scientists building search or recommendation systems  |  Access: Free  |  Ease of Use: 4.7/5

What Is This Course?

DeepLearning.AI’s Embedding Models course teaches intermediate practitioners how to design, train, and deploy embedding architectures. In 2026, mastering embeddings is essential for search, recommendation, and LLM‑enhanced products. The hour‑long, self‑paced format fits busy professionals seeking practical, production‑ready knowledge.

Embedding models turn raw data into dense vectors that power similarity search, personalization, and LLM retrieval‑augmented generation. LangChain provides the orchestration layer to plug these embeddings into applications, while Embeddings category content shows where vector databases fit in the stack. The course equips decision‑makers to evaluate ROI of vector‑based features versus traditional heuristics.

Who This Course Is For

Data scientists: — Need a concise, production‑focused grounding in embedding theory.

ML engineers: — Want step‑by‑step guidance to integrate embeddings into pipelines.

Product managers: — Require enough technical insight to prioritize embedding projects.

AI consultants: — Seek a quick refresher to advise clients on vector search solutions.

What You Will Learn

Foundations

Understanding Embedding Theory — From Linear Algebra to Neural Nets

Covers the mathematical basis of vector representations and why they outperform one‑hot encodings in similarity tasks. Learners see how dimensionality reduction preserves semantic relationships.

Architectures

Designing CNN, RNN, and Transformer Embedding Models

Walks through practical model choices for text, images, and multimodal data, highlighting trade‑offs in latency and accuracy.

Training

Efficient Training Strategies and Loss Functions

Explains contrastive loss, triplet loss, and negative sampling, plus tips for scaling training on cloud GPUs.

Evaluation

Measuring Embedding Quality with Retrieval Benchmarks

Introduces intrinsic and extrinsic metrics, and demonstrates evaluation pipelines using open datasets.

Deployment

Serving Embeddings with Vector Databases

Shows how to index vectors in Pinecone or similar services and query them efficiently at scale.

Integration

Connecting Embeddings to LLMs via Retrieval‑Augmented Generation

Demonstrates RAG patterns that combine static embeddings with generative models to improve answer relevance.

How to Access This Course

The Embedding Models course is completely free. No credit‑card information is required and learners can start instantly. As a self‑paced offering, participants can pause and resume at any time, making it ideal for busy professionals.

Where This Course Excels

Focused on production — Each module includes real‑world deployment guidance, not just theory.

Concise format — One‑hour length respects busy schedules while covering essential depth.

Free certification — Learners earn a badge without any payment, adding credibility.

Integration examples — Shows how embeddings work with vector DBs and LLMs, bridging two hot AI trends.

Limitations & What It Doesn't Cover

Assumes Python fluency — Code snippets may be too fast for beginners.

Limited hands‑on labs — No interactive notebook environment; learners must set up locally.

Depth over breadth — Covers core topics well but omits niche embedding types like graph embeddings.

Professional reality — Teams without existing data pipelines will need extra engineering effort to apply lessons.

Getting Started

  1. Step 1: Visit deeplearning.ai and navigate to the Embedding Models course page.
  2. Step 2: Click the “Enroll Free” button.
  3. Step 3: Create or log into your DeepLearning.AI account.
  4. Step 4: Launch Module 1 and begin learning immediately.

Is This Course Worth It?

For professionals who need a rapid, production‑ready grounding in embeddings, the course delivers high ROI at zero cost. Its strength lies in concise, deployment‑focused modules, while the main limitation is the expectation of solid Python skills. Small to mid‑size AI teams will gain the most immediate value, especially when paired with vector databases.

Alternatives to Consider

Fast.ai Practical Deep Learning for Coders — Provides a hands‑on, free deep‑learning curriculum with broader model coverage.

Stanford CS224U – Natural Language Understanding — Offers a free, university‑level deep dive into language representations and semantics.

Google AI – Machine Learning Crash Course — Delivers a free, interactive introduction to ML fundamentals, including embeddings basics.

Verdict

Bottom Line: Invest in the Embedding Models course if your team needs a quick, free path to production‑ready vector techniques. It delivers solid ROI for technically proficient learners, but it’s not suited for absolute beginners.

Key Takeaways

  • Embedding Models course is ideal for data scientists and engineers needing fast, production‑ready vector knowledge.
  • Free enrollment with a verifiable completion badge adds credibility without expense.
  • Strength: Concise modules with real‑world deployment guidance; Limitation: Assumes solid Python background.

Frequently Asked Questions

Yes, the entire curriculum, including quizzes and the completion badge, is available at no cost and does not require a credit card.
A solid grasp of Python and basic machine‑learning concepts is expected; the course does not cover introductory programming.
It focuses exclusively on vector representations and their deployment, whereas full NLP tracks cover broader topics like parsing, translation, and language modeling.
Yes, upon completing all modules and passing the final quiz, a free certificate of completion is awarded.
The fast pace assumes programming fluency, offers limited interactive labs, and does not explore niche embedding types such as graph or hyperbolic embeddings.

AI Tools to Use Alongside This Course

Practising what you learn is where the real value kicks in. These tools pair directly with the skills covered in this course:

LangChain

Provides the orchestration layer to integrate embeddings into LLM applications.

Ready to put your new skills to work?

Browse All AI Tools →

Last Reviewed: June 2026 | Reviewed by theaitoolsbox.com editorial team

🎯 Who This Course Is For

Data scientists: Need a concise, production‑focused grounding in embedding theory. ML engineers: Want step‑by‑step guidance to integrate embeddings into pipelines. Product managers: Require enough technical insight to prioritize embedding projects. AI consultants: Seek a quick refresher to advise clients on vector search solutions.

Pros & Cons

What We Love

  • Focused on production: Each module includes real‑world deployment guidance, not just theory.
  • Concise format: One‑hour length respects busy schedules while covering essential depth.
  • Free certification: Learners earn a badge without any payment, adding credibility.
  • Integration examples: Shows how embeddings work with vector DBs and LLMs, bridging two hot AI trends.

Watch Out For

  • Assumes Python fluency
  • Limited hands‑on labs
  • Depth over breadth

Ready to Start Learning?

This course is completely free. No signup required.

Start Learning Free

Course Details

Price
Free
Level
Intermediate
Duration
1 hour
Topic
Embeddings
Instructor
DeepLearning.AI
Rating
★ 4.5/5
Platform
DeepLearning.AI
Watch Free Now

More Free AI Courses


★ UNDERSTANDING-AND-A… Free
🎓

Understanding and Applying Text Embeddings

Embeddings
By DeepLearning.AI

This beginner-friendly course demystifies text embeddings, showing how they power search, recommendation, and classification systems. It equips data scientists and …

★★★★★ 4.5/5
🤖 DeepLearning.AI
Duration
1 hour
Level
Beginner
View Course →

★ FAST-EFFICIENT-LLM-… Free
🎓

Fast & Efficient LLM Inference with vLLM

LLM Serving
By DeepLearning.AI

The Fast & Efficient LLM Inference with vLLM course equips intermediate AI engineers with practical techniques to serve large language …

★★★★★ 4.5/5
🤖 DeepLearning.AI
Duration
1 hour
Level
Intermediate
View Course →

★ BUILDING-MULTIMODAL… Free
🎓

Building Multimodal Data Pipelines

Data Processing
By DeepLearning.AI

DeepLearning.AI's Building Multimodal Data Pipelines course equips data engineers and ML practitioners with a practical framework for integrating text, image, …

★★★★★ 4.5/5
🤖 DeepLearning.AI
Duration
1 hour
Level
Intermediate
View Course →

★ AGENT-SKILLS-WITH-A… Free
🎓

Agent Skills with Anthropic

Agents
By DeepLearning.AI

This one‑hour intermediate course from DeepLearning.AI equips product teams and AI practitioners with practical techniques for prompting, fine‑tuning, and integrating …

★★★★★ 4.5/5
🤖 DeepLearning.AI
Duration
1 hour
Level
Intermediate
View Course →

★ BUILD-AND-TRAIN-AN-… Free
🎓

Build and Train an LLM with JAX

Deep Learning
By DeepLearning.AI

DeepLearning.AI’s one‑hour, intermediate‑level course teaches engineers how to build and fine‑tune large language models with JAX. It focuses on practical …

★★★★★ 4.5/5
🤖 DeepLearning.AI
Duration
1 hour
Level
Intermediate
View Course →

★ TENSORFLOW-DEVELOPE… Free
🎓

TensorFlow Developer Professional Certificate

Deep Learning
By DeepLearning.AI

The TensorFlow Developer Professional Certificate from DeepLearning.AI offers a structured pathway for professionals aiming to build production‑ready machine‑learning models. As …

★★★★★ 4.5/5
🤖 DeepLearning.AI
Duration
Multi-course
Level
Intermediate
View Course →